Erro ao instalar zlib1g-dev na área de trabalho do Ubuntu 16.04

Erro ao instalar zlib1g-dev na área de trabalho do Ubuntu 16.04

Estou tentando instalar o ffmpeg no Ubuntu 16.04 e ele possui um pacote de dependência zlib1g-dev. ao correr sudo apt-get install zlib1g-dev. Estou recebendo o erro abaixo

The following packages have unmet dependencies:
 zlib1g-dev : Depends: zlib1g (= 1:1.2.8.dfsg-2ubuntu4) but 1:1.2.8.dfsg-2ubuntu4.1 is to be installed
E: Unable to correct problems, you have held broken packages.

Li em algum lugar que pode ser devido a um problema no sources.list. Verifiquei sources.listo arquivo e parece estar correto e verifiquei com este link (https://gist.github.com/rohitrawat/60a04e6ebe4a9ec1203eac3a11d4afc1) e sudo apt-get updatetambém não mostra nenhum erro. Você pode sugerir. Obrigado!!!

EDIT 1: Também segui a solução neste link (E: Incapaz de corrigir problemas, você guardou pacotes quebrados) e executei sudo apt-mark showhold mas não imprimiu nada. Então não consegui desmarcar nada também tentei a solução com o aptitude e o log executando sudo aptitude install zlib1g-dev foi:

Os seguintes NOVOS pacotes serão instalados: zlib1g-dev{b} 0 pacotes atualizados, 1 recém-instalado, 0 para remover e 17 não atualizados. Precisa obter 168 KB de arquivos. Após descompactar, serão usados ​​426 kB. Os seguintes pacotes têm dependências não atendidas: zlib1g-dev: Depende: zlib1g (= 1:1.2.8.dfsg-2ubuntu4) mas 1:1.2.8.dfsg-2ubuntu4.1 está instalado. As ações a seguir resolverão essas dependências:

 Keep the following packages at their current version:

1) zlib1g-dev [Não instalado]

Aceita esta solução? [S/n/q/?] s Nenhum pacote será instalado, atualizado ou removido. 0 pacotes atualizados, 0 recém-instalados, 0 para remover e 17 não atualizados. Precisa obter 0 B de arquivos. Após desembalar, 0 B será usado.

Responder1

A resposta para isso é dada pela SeinopSys emErro ao instalar zlib1g-dev você precisa anotar a versão do pacote necessária (no seu caso = 1:1.2.8.dfsg-2ubuntu4) e executar o comando abaixo para fazer o downgrade para essa versão:

$ sudo apt install zlib1g=1:1.2.8.dfsg-2ubuntu4

Então você pode tentar reinstalar.

informação relacionada